Most Popular Washington Schools for a Bachelor's in Architectural Sciences
Our analysis found University of Washington - Seattle Campus to be the most popular school for architectural sciences and technology students who want to pursue a bachelor’s degree in Washington. UW Seattle is a fairly large public school located in the city of Seattle.
Of the 70 students majoring in architect science at UW Seattle, 79% are male and 21% are female.
While working on their Bachelor's Degree, architect science majors at UW Seattle accumulate an average of around $18,745 in student debt.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Washington State University. It ranked #2 on our 2023 Most Popular Architectural Sciences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Washington list. Located in the distant town of Pullman, Wazzu is a public school with a very large student population.
Of the 55 students majoring in architect science at Wazzu, 69% are male and 31% are female.
